Aerobic respiratory pathway is appropriately termed:
Options
(a) parabolic
(b) amphibolic
(c) anabolic
(d) catabolic
Correct Answer:
amphibolic
Explanation:
All energy-releasing pathways whether aerobic (requiring oxygen) begin with a pathway called glycolysis, which occurs in the cytoplasm (cytosol). Aerobic respiratory pathway is appropriately termed amphibolic. Aerobic respiration is the main energy-releasing pathway leading to ATP formation. It occurs in the mitochondria. Aerobic respiration yields thirty-six ATP.
